Teachers around the world have expressed concern over a new wave of online misogyny linked to British-American influencer Andrew Tate.

What is online misogyny? And what should be done about it?

Start the discussion in your classroom and help students explore different opinions people have about misogyny online.

Use this one-hour lesson to help your students:

  • Identify the theme of misogyny in news stories
  • Compare different perspectives
  • Discuss solutions to online misogyny
